Send Copied Text Between Android Phone and Windows 11 for FREE

The name of the app is KDE Connect.

 

 

On Windows, install the app via Microsoft Store.

On Android phone, install the app via play Store.

The test steps - KDE Connect 23.801.1463.0
OS: Windows 11 Home
Install from Microsoft Store

KDE Connect 1.29
OS: Android 12
Install from Play Store


1. Install the app in Android and Windows 11.

Connect the phone and PC to the same Wi-Fi network.

On Windows 11, open the app.


Double click the name of your phone in the app's window.


Click Pair.


On the phone, check the notification center, tap 'Pair requested' then tap 'Accept'. If it expires, you can request it.

You will see the window just like the picture above.

On the phone, tap the name of your PC.

You will see the interface just like the picture above.

2. Copy text on Windows.


Click 'Send Clipboard' in app's window.


Copied text will be sent to the phone.

3. Copy text on the phone.

Tap 'Send Clipboard'

On Windows, you can get copied text by pasting it.

Cast Android Phone Screen to Windows 11 Screen For FREE

With this app, you can not control a phone via Windows 11, just take a benefit from a big screen to show what you see in your phone screen. Then you can take a screenshot or cast Windows screen to anywhere else. There is no audio in this free version.

 

The test steps - EasyCast 1.6.2.0
OS: Windows 11 Home
Install from Microsoft Store

EasyCast 1.9.6
OS: Android 12
Install from Play Store


1. Install this app on Windows.


 Open it.

 

App's icon at the taskbar.

You must install this app on the phone via 'Play Store'.


Make sure your phone and PC are in the same Wi-Fi network.

On the phone, open the app, then grant permission.

I chose 'While using this app'.

Tap 'Broadcast Screen'.

Choose your device.

Tap 'Start Now'. Your phone's screen should be displayed on the PC.

2. From my observation, when the phone is in a vertical position, the picture I will get on PC just like the picture below.

When the phone is in a horizontal position, A thing gets better.

In the picture above, phone is in a horizontal position, I activated this app on Windows 11 and press 'f' to access a full-screen mode.

In the picture above, phone is in a vertical position, I activated this app on Windows 11 and press 'f' to access a full-screen mode. (f is a shortcut to toggle full-screen mode for this app)

I tried YouTube app and an easy game, they worked fine with this app.


That's it, EasyCast is easy to use but if you want more quality and audio, you might consider in-app purchases.

Vysor (FREE version) - Control Android Phone from Windows 11

Recording the Android phone screen can be done with this Free app. This app can make your Android screen display on Windows desktop. Users can use a mouse and a keyboard of PC to control the phone - clicking, scrolling and typing. That way you can use apps on Windows to record it, edit screenshots,etc...

The test steps - Vysor FREE version 4.2.6
OS: Windows 11 Home
Download: https://www.vysor.io/

 

1. From the picture above, click a button 'Download', then click a button 'Windows' and wait until downloading finishes. Open folder 'Downloads'.


 Open file 'Vysor-win-4.1.77'.

 

There is a Windows firewall, I checked 'Private network..' and clicked a button 'Allow'

I already plugged in an Android phone via USB.

But Vysor windows showed message (see the picture below).


I thought I already enabled USB debugging, so I clicked a link to download 'ADB Drivers'.

A webpage opened, I clicked 'Download Drivers'.


When downloading finished, opened folder 'Downloads' and opened a file 'UniversalAdbDriverSetup'

Just follow the on-screen instructions to install the driver.

I unplugged the phone and plugged it again, nothing happened until I realized that USB debugging on the phone was not enabled.

2. To enable USB debugging, follow the steps. My operating system is Android version 12.


 a. Tap 'Settings'.


 Tap 'About phone'.


 Tap 'Software information'.

Tap 'Build number' 7 times until you see a message 'Developer mode has been turned on'. - after the first 3 times, there is a message 'You are now 4 steps away from being a developer'.

Tap back (the arrow in the picture below)

Tap icon to search (see the picture below)

Type 'debug' in the search box, then tap 'USB debugging' in the search results.

b. Tap to turn on 'USB debugging'.

There is a warning. (see the picture below)


Tap 'OK'

In Vysor window, there is a play button.

In the phone, there is a message 'Allow USB debugging? The computer's RSA key...'.

Tap 'Allow'. In my Vysor window, text showed 'SM A025F' (I think that text will be changed depending on the phone model). 

In my case, the was a message 'Allow access to phone data?'.

 

I tapped 'Allow' to transfer files from the phone to Windows. The message 'Allow USB debugging? The computer's RSA key...' showed again, I had to tap 'Allow' again.

C. In Vysor window, click 'Play' button. The phone screen will show on Windows desktop.

In the picture above, the areas in 2 rectangles are parts of the Vysor app. I could use a mouse to click the icons, scroll it to see the contents on the a long page. I could use a PC keybord to type to the text box.

I clicked the gear icon to see other options.

I clicked 'Rotate Screen'.
